Debate examines religion and the military

The issue of religion in the military returned to ground zero Tuesday, April 24, as the Faculty Forum hosted a debate about the appropriate balance between religious freedom and the official religious neutrality of the military.

General Fogleman receives USAFA T.D. White award

Retired General Ronald R. Fogleman, the 16th Air Force Chief of Staff, received the United States Air Force Academy T.D. White Award here Wednesday, May 2.

C4C Melissa Beerse shatters Academy pole vault record

C4C Melissa Beerse smashed her own Academy record in the pole vault, as the Air Force track and field team competed at the Wyoming Invitational on Saturday, April 28. Beerse cleared a career-best 12'9½" to win the event, improve her NCAA Regional Qualifying standard and set a new AirForceAcademy record.


Falcons drop 11-9 contest to Denver

Despite holding a four-goal lead in the first half, the Air Force lacrosse team could not hold off a late Denver rally, falling to the Pioneers, 11-9, Saturday evening at Barton Lacrosse Stadium.

 

Sprint Medley Relay Team crushes 41-year old Academy record

Four members of the Air Force track and field team combined to set a new Academy standard in the sprint medley relay as the Falcons concluded competition at the 98th-annual Drake Relays in Des Moines, Iowa, on Saturday, April 28.
